In today’s video, you will learn how to stop Outlook from asking for username and password.
Launch Outlook app. Minimize the window. Open Google Chrome browser. Click on the account icon at the top right corner of your screen and click on ‘Google Account’ button.
Go to ‘Sign-in & security’. Scroll down and look for ‘Allow less secure apps’. Turn the switch on. Minimize the window.
Enter your password in Outlook app. Check ‘Save the password in your password list’. Click ‘Ok’.
